This detached bungalow from 2022 sits at the edge of the forest, a sheltered spot outside the built-up area in a wooded setting. The asking price is €226,500, which is on the high side for the 50 m² of living space the agent lists. This listing does not state the energy label. As a result, you cannot tell from the listing how energy-efficient the home is. The agent describes the home as fully insulated with double glazing, and it has a central heating boiler. There are six rooms in total, including two bedrooms and two bathrooms, all on one floor. The living area is 50 m² according to the agent, while the BAG registration records 45 m². The plot is 378 m² in both sources.

For daily groceries, the nearest supermarket is the Coop, about a ten-minute walk away, and the SPAR is just around the corner. The Christelijke Basisschool Prins Bernhard is a couple of streets away, and the GP practice Medisch Centrum Garderen is about a ten-minute walk. Bus line 107 stops at Garderen, De Hertshoorn, just around the corner. The nearest train station is Putten, about 8 km away. According to area-level risk data, the noise from road traffic is 39 dB Lden, which is not above the noise standard. The foundation risk indication is low, and the soil type is classified as 'other'. For climate risks, pluvial flooding is low, and the flood risk is low both now and in 2050. These are indications at the area level, not an inspection of this specific home.

The asking price is €226,500. The agent lists the living area as 50 m², which works out to €4,530 per m². This is a relatively high price per square metre, but the home is a modern bungalow from 2022 in a wooded setting. There is no WOZ value available, so we cannot compare the asking price with the municipal valuation.
According to the agent, the home has six rooms in total, including two bedrooms and two bathrooms. It is a single-storey bungalow, so all rooms are on one floor. The living area is 50 m² according to the agent, while the BAG registration records 45 m². The plot is 378 m².
The agent has not published this field. As a result, you cannot tell from the listing how energy-efficient the home is. The agent does mention that the home is fully insulated with double glazing and has a central heating boiler.
According to area-level risk data, the foundation risk indication is low. The soil type is classified as 'other'. This is an indication at the area level, not an inspection of this specific home. The flood risk is also low, both now and in 2050, and pluvial flooding is low.
The nearest supermarket is the Coop, about 1.6 km away, and the SPAR is about 1.8 km away. There are two supermarkets within 5 km. For a wider choice, the Aldi and Jumbo are about 5.6 km and 5.9 km away respectively.
The nearest primary school is Christelijke Basisschool Prins Bernhard, about 1.7 km away. Other primary schools within 5 km include Speulderbrink School met de Bijbel and Openbare Basisschool De Schovenhorst. For secondary education, the nearest is about 6 km away.
The nearest bus stop is Garderen, De Hertshoorn, about 377 m away, served by bus line 107. There are also stops at Garderen, Heideheuvel and Garderen, Buurtstraat. The nearest train station is Putten, about 8.3 km away.
